What moves the price on a 2018 Ford Expedition
The $18,730–$20,249 typical range isn't randomness — two factors explain most of it:
Asking prices run about $28,000 at 45K–60K miles and fall to $19,495 over 105K miles — roughly $1,400 for every 10,000 miles.
The XLT typically asks $19,559, while the Platinum asks $25,443 — same year, same market.

Frequently asked questions
Why do 2018 Ford Expedition prices range from $14,838 to $24,613 in Kansas?
The spread comes down to configuration and mileage: higher-mileage, base-configuration examples sit near the low end, while low-mileage and premium configurations reach the top. Half of all listings fall between $18,730 and $20,249 — see the mileage and trim breakdowns above for where a specific vehicle lands.
How much should mileage change the price of a 2018 Ford Expedition?
Expect roughly $1,400 less for every 10,000 miles on the odometer. A 60K-mile example should cost about $4,200 less than a 30K-mile one of the same trim — check the fair-price-by-mileage table above for your band.
Do Ford Expedition prices in Kansas differ from the rest of the country?
Yes. The average in Kansas is $19,454, which is $2,218 below the national average of $21,672. Local supply, demand and transport costs all play a part.

How we calculate these prices
We track 5 active listings for this vehicle across dealer sites nationwide, updated every day. Average and median are computed from real asking prices on live listings. We exclude the top and bottom 2% of prices to remove data errors, salvage titles, and monthly-payment figures posted as if they were sale prices. Prices reflect dealer asking prices — not final sale prices — and exclude taxes, fees, and incentives. Trim and mileage move the price more than any other factor; see the breakdowns above.
